Banjul, The Gambia

After another day at sea we sailed up the Gambia River to the city of Banjul. After docking, we rode through Banjul past the April 22nd Arch. Following the Gambia River, we traveled through Serekunda Town to the Abuko Nature Reserve. Here our guide took us on an hour and a half walk through the reserve. On our return trip we passed many every day african scenes. Upon our arrival back at the ship there were local venders and craft people displaying their wares on the pier.
